This crucial Campaign is in response to the increase in<br>the systematic violence against women and the growing number of murders of women and<br>young girls by male family members on the pretext of preserving family\u2019s \u201chonor\u201d.<br>The inadequacy of the laws and the judiciary system, under the protection of the governing<br>Sharia and the perpetrators often receive disproportionally light sentences , have failed to<br>prevent such crimes, and perpetrators have received disproportionally light sentences.<br>Victims of \u201chonor\u201d killings are often women and young girls who have refused forced<br>marriages, filed for divorce, demanded freedom to make decisions objected to by the family<br>and\u2026. They are murdered in the most brutal methods ways, by axe, sickle, poison, and\u2026.<br>Familial, ethnic and tribal traditions and prejudices, condoned by religious and judicial<br>institutions, together with the prevailing patriarchal culture allow the continuation of \u201chonor\u201d<br>killings in the total silence of the state media.<br>Women and children along with other marginalized groups of gender, sex, religious and ethnic<br>minorities are not protected by law; therefore many incidents of \u201chonor\u201d killings are not<br>registered in the official databases.<br>Sharia laws, in particular articles of the Islamic Penal Code, together with the discriminatory<br>viewpoints of the legislators and the judiciary system, allow men to kill women and young girls<br>in their kinship with impunity. Fourteen years old Romina Ashrafi was beheaded by her father.<br>He received only a nine years sentence. The murderer of twenty two-years old Fatemeh Barhi,<br>another recent victim of \u201chonor\u201d killing in Iran, was freed from prison after serving only two<br>months.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>2<br>We believe that the laws must protect the society\u2019s interest and the people, regardless of<br>gender, religious beliefs, ethnicity and race.
